Kinds of Lipo Techniques
When thinking about liposuction surgery, it's vital to know that there are numerous strategies readily available, each customized to fulfill various demands and choices. Standard liposuction uses a cannula to suction fat from targeted areas through tiny lacerations. Tumescent liposuction involves infusing a remedy to numb the area and reduce blood loss.
Laser-assisted lipo, or SmartLipo, makes use of laser energy to dissolve fat before elimination, making it much less intrusive and advertising skin tightening up (Lipo In Austin). Ultrasound-assisted liposuction utilizes ultrasound waves to break down fat cells, making them simpler to extract
For a gentler method, power-assisted lipo uses a vibrating cannula, reducing the initiative required for fat elimination. Each technique has its advantages and potential downsides, so it's necessary to discuss these alternatives with your specialist. Recognizing these methods can assist you make an informed choice that straightens with your objectives.
Ideal Candidates for Lipo Therapy
Suitable candidates for lipo treatment typically have details features that make them ideal for the treatment. You should go to or near your excellent weight, as lipo isn't a weight-loss solution yet a fat reduction approach. Great skin flexibility is likewise essential; this aids your skin adapt to your new physique post-treatment. If you remain in good general wellness and don't have conditions that can complicate surgical treatment, you're more probable to be an excellent candidate.

Potential Risks and Issues
Although lipo therapy is generally risk-free, it is essential to be knowledgeable about prospective threats and complications that can occur. You may encounter issues like infection, which can occur if proper aftercare isn't complied with. There's additionally the risk of excessive bleeding, resulting in hematomas and even requiring extra procedures. Some individuals experience unequal shapes or skin abnormalities, which could not deal with on their very own.
In rare cases, you could experience more severe difficulties like blood clots or adverse responses to anesthesia. Nerve damages is an additional opportunity, leading to permanent or short-term tingling in the cured area. Additionally, you might deal with liquid buildup, needing drainage.
It's vital to have an honest conversation with your doctor regarding these dangers and ensure you're well-informed. By understanding these possible issues, you can make a much more educated choice about whether lipo therapy is ideal for you.

Preliminary Recovery Stage
As you start your recovery from lipo treatment, it is very important to recognize what to anticipate during the initial healing phase. In the first couple of days, you could experience swelling, wounding, and some pain. These symptoms are normal and commonly improve in time. You'll likely observe water drainage from your incisions, which becomes part of the healing process. It's vital to follow your surgeon's aftercare instructions, including wearing compression garments to help lower swelling and support your brand-new shapes. Maintain an eye on your cuts for any kind of indicators of infection, like raised soreness or discharge. Staying moisturized and eating a balanced diet can also assist your healing. Remember, perseverance is vital as your body heals and changes.

Cost Factors To Consider and Budgeting for Lipo
Lipo therapy can significantly differ in expense, making it essential to recognize what influences prices prior to deciding. A number of factors enter play, consisting of the kind of lipo procedure, the doctor's experience, and your geographical location. Typically, you can expect costs to range from $2,000 to $7,000 per session.
Do not neglect to account for additional costs, such as anesthetic, facility fees, and post-operative care. It's a good idea to seek advice from with multiple centers to contrast solutions and prices. Some facilities provide funding options or layaway plan, which can aid spread the price in time.
Prior to devoting, confirm you're clear on what's consisted of in the quoted price. Keep in mind, the most inexpensive option isn't always the very best; prioritize high quality and safety and security over savings.
